使用Arduino开发STM32之环境搭建(附带小鱼的唠叨)
发布网友
发布时间:17小时前
我来回答
共0个回答
使用Arduino开发STM32之环境搭建(附带小鱼的唠叨)
安装步骤如下:运行一键安装链接安装VSCode并搜索平台IO插件初始化和安装PlatformIO IDE,注意可能需要手动操作在VSCode中新建并配置工程编写并运行代码,包括上传工具安装设置下载模式和多板子支持这篇文章提供了详尽的步骤,如果你对Arduino开发STM32感兴趣,别忘了尝试并分享你的成果哦!
STM32F103R8T6,了解一下?
STM32F103R8T6是ST旗下的一款常用的增强型系列微控制器,是一款基于ARM Cortex-M内核的微控制器。STM32F103R8T6主要面向消费类电子产品、工业控制、医疗仪器、汽车电子等领域,可用于开发各种类型的应用。STM32F103R8T6具有以下特点:1. 集成了多种外设:USART、SPI、I2C、UART等,方便开发者使用。2. 高性能:采用了ARM Cortex-M内核,处理速度较快,可以支持复杂的应用程序。3. 低功耗:芯片采用了LPW(低功耗、高性能)技术,可以使得该微控制器在低功耗下运行,适合移动设备和物联网应用。4. 丰富的外围接口:STM32F103R8T6提供了丰富的外围接口…意法半导体致力于引领单片机技术和产品的创新,推动生态系统的建设,为用户提供满意的产品和技术服务。意法半导体单片机产品线拥有业界宽广、极具创新力的32位产品系列 – STM32,覆盖超低功耗、超高性能方向,同时兼具很强的市场竞争力。STM32...
Arduino借助STM32Duino开发STM32教程-(2023年8月)
开发环境搭建首先,从Arduino官网下载并安装Arduino IDE 2,其提供了丰富的代码补全和改进的UI,以及DEBUG支持。安装完成后,你需要添加STM32Duino开发板支持,它兼容大多数STM32芯片。安装与配置打开IDE后,通过开发板管理器添加STM32芯片包,建议选择最新版本。由于服务器在国外,可能需要配置网络选项来加速...
如何用arduino的ide编译stm32
用arduino的ide编译stm32方法:1,先说说arduino是个什么东西 arduino说白了就是有人写了一个库把芯片寄存器还有一些外围的部件抽象出来了,使用arduino就像是在pc上写模拟器一样,不需要我们写任何硬件相关代码 2,stm32如果要像arduino的avr系列那样控制的话,也需要有一个库能把他抽象出来,把他的一些...
Arduino IDE for ESP32开发环境搭建
搭建Arduino IDE与ESP32开发环境的步骤分为三部分:安装Arduino IDE、下载ESP32文件包以及使用ESP32开发板。首先,访问Arduino官网下载并安装Arduino IDE,选择适合的版本,完成安装。IDE安装成功后,运行界面。接着,由于Arduino IDE默认开发版管理器中缺少ESP32文件包,需要手动安装。在线方式包括:登录GitHub...
Arduino开发库STM32Duino离线包封装2.7.0(2023年11月版)_将github的jso...
在使用Arduino开发STM32时,很多开发者遇到网络问题,导致只能访问到github和json安装版本2.2.0,这在一定程度上限制了开发STM32F1和STM32F4系列的便利性,而对于STM32H7xx系列,这一版本就显得较为老旧。为解决这一问题,我整理并打包了STM32Duino从2.5.0到2.7.0的离线包,通过本地web服务,开发...
Arduino 中集成编写stm8和stm32
在 Arduino 开发 STM32 时,有两个集成库可供选择。第一个是 Arduino_STM32,它提供了 STM32 板支持的硬件文件,适用于 Arduino IDE 1.8.x,包括 LeafLabs Maple 和其他通用 STM32F103 板。第二个集成库是 Arduino_Core_STM32,由官方维护,提供的 STM32 类型更多,因此在实际使用中,推荐使用这个...
用Arduino IDE对STM32 Blue Pill进行编程
Arduino IDE,这个在电子爱好者和工程师间广受欢迎的工具,虽然以其8位CPU和相对较低的时钟速度见长,但与STM32F103C8T6结合后,全新的编程可能性就显现出来。你可以在Arduino IDE上直接对STM32 Blue Pill进行编程,这款基于STM32F103C8T6的开发板因其蓝色PCB而得名,其性能远超Arduino Uno。项目所需...
stm32开发板兼容arduino什么意思
Arduino是一款便捷灵活、方便上手的开源电子原型平台。它构建于开放原始码simpleI,O介面版,并且具有使用类似Java、C语言ProcessingWiring开发环境。主要包含两个主要的部分:硬件部分是可以用来做电路连接的Arduino电路板;另外一个则是ArduinoIDE,你的计算机中的程序开发环境。你只要在IDE中编写程序代码,将...
51单片机,stm32,arduino都是用什么语言进行编程的?
STM32单片机是意法半导体推出的高性价比、片上资源丰富的32位单片机,这个系列的单片机我一直在用,都是用C语言进行编程,官方推出的库函数和HAL库都是用C语言编程的,虽然有一部分汇编共存。STM32单片机用KeilMDK进行编程。Arduino的编程 Arduino是一款做的非常成功的开源硬件,并且有自己的开发环境,将...
STM32CUBEMX开发GD32F303(16)---移植兆易创新SPI Nor Flash之GD25Q64F...
STM32CUBEMX开发GD32F303中,SPI(Serial Peripheral Interface)是一种全双工、同步的通信方式,仅需四根线,如W25Q64 Flash,支持SPI模式0和模式3。GD25Q64是一款64Mbit的SPI闪存,适合多种嵌入式应用。课程资源包括视频教程和详细的CSDN教程,通过实际开发板验证。移植过程包括配置64M时钟,PA9和PA10...